Protocol Education is working with secondary schools across Bristol and the wider South West looking for reliable Cover Supervisors to step in when teachers are away. You’ll deliver pre-set work, manage behaviour, and keep lessons running smoothly — no planning required.

What you’ll be doing

• Supervising classes across KS3 and KS4 using pre-prepared lesson plans
• Maintaining calm, purposeful classrooms and managing behaviour confidently
• Reinforcing school routines, expectations, and behaviour policies
• Dealing with low-level disruption and knowing when to escalate
• Supporting pupils to stay engaged and focused on their work
